How Our Structural Drying Services Process Works
A proper structural drying service needs a thorough process to ensure that your property is completely dry and safe. Our team will work closely with you to develop a customized plan that meets your unique needs and budget. We’ll use advanced equipment to extract standing water, dry out affected areas, and prevent further damage.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team will conduct a thorough assessment of your property to identify the source and extent of the water damage. We’ll work with you to develop a customized plan that meets your needs and budget. Our technicians will take precise measurements to ensure that we’re using the right equipment for the job.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Our team will use advanced equipment to quickly and efficiently remove standing water from your property. We’ll use truck-mounted extractors to get the job done fast and effectively. Our technicians will also use specialized equipment to remove water from hard-to-reach areas such as crawlspaces and attics.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the standing water has been removed, our team will use specialized equipment to dry out affected areas. We’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air and prevent further damage. Our technicians will also use high-velocity fans to speed up the drying process.
Step 4: Monitoring and Verification
Our team will regularly monitor the drying process to ensure that your property is completely dry and safe. We’ll take precise measurements to verify that the moisture levels have returned to normal. Our technicians will also inspect for any signs of further damage and address them quickly.

Structural Drying Services Cost in Lincoln, AR
The cost of structural drying services can vary widely dep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Lincoln, AR. These are estimates, not guarantees. Our team will work closely with you to develop a customized plan that meets your needs and budget.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of water damage |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used |
| Monitoring and Verification | $500 – $2,000 | Frequency and duration of monitoring |
| Repair and Re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Scope of repairs, materials used |
| Disinfection and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of disinfectant used |
| Documentation and Reporting | $500 – $2,000 | Scope of documentation, complexity of report |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ment by our team. We offer free estimates to help you plan and budget for your structural drying services.
